The Black Crowes were planning their return to the stage in 2020
Monday activity on social networking one of the most emblematic groups of the '90s like The Black Crowes began to move and rumors that marked a possible meeting slowly taking shape.
The group, founded by brothers Chris and Rich Robinson earned a deserved place thanks to a unique sound, inspired by the southern rock. They won him worldwide fame, recording several albums and successful since its debut in "Shake Your Money Maker".
It is precisely that record which comply 30 years in 2020, so the group would have decided together to celebrate with a world tour. Early indications were the new logos, and uploaded in their social networks and advertising in American public roads.
The medium itself The Wall Street Journal was aware of the news and contacted Pete Angelus, former manager of the group, who he explained that the Robinson brothers were in talks with Live Nation executives to carry on their world tour.
Another said medium contacts drummer Steve Gorman was, who said he knew the news but so far was not invited to return to his former fellow travelers.
It is recalled that the group decided to split into 2015, being “Before the frost…until the freeze” (2009) the last studio album released.
It is recalled that the band was already in our country, more precisely in January 1996, when they opened the historic concert of former Led Zeppelin Jimmy Page and Robert Plant, in Ferrocarril Oeste Stadium.
